The Wizard
George gets upset that Jerry entrusted Elaine to get his mail. To avoid conflict, Jerry quickly gives George the important job of flushing his toilets twice a day so the gaskets won't dry out and leak. George then feels better by having, what he feels is, a "bigger responsibilty" than Elaine. Toilets are everything to George.
